substitute teaching thats what i do. all u need is atleast 60 college hours, but if you only have a high school diploma you can sub for a classroom aide or for a secertary. it is a very flexible job you make your own schedule and if you have a bachelors degree you will get called more than anybody i know because i get called all the time. it is also good to apply in the school district that you live in. some schools pay a high as 80 dollars a day! you can get 400 dallars in on month really easy or you can make more but it depends on how often you are willing to work. hope you will check it out!
